Pro Medicus Limited (PMCUF)
OTCMKTS · Delayed Price · Currency is USD
122.08
+4.08 (3.46%)
At close: Feb 11, 2026

Pro Medicus Ratios and Metrics

Millions USD. Fiscal year is Jul - Jun.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Jun '25 Jun '24 Jun '23 Jun '22 Jun '21
9,59319,5249,9814,5623,0364,588
Market Cap Growth
-47.13%95.61%118.77%50.29%-33.83%141.60%
Enterprise Value
9,46219,4069,8954,5012,9854,552
Last Close Price
122.08184.8292.6242.8229.0043.52
PE Ratio
61.28258.47180.69113.0399.14198.36
PS Ratio
59.64139.8392.6354.8847.1489.91
PB Ratio
36.98115.8979.6949.4043.3174.92
P/TBV Ratio
39.20126.0889.2358.3855.4699.22
P/FCF Ratio
112.91268.55183.17110.1471.83158.07
P/OCF Ratio
112.50267.49182.49109.6271.55157.55
EV/Sales Ratio
55.13138.9891.8354.1546.3589.20
EV/EBITDA Ratio
40.35187.20131.1780.1670.34141.55
EV/EBIT Ratio
40.53187.59131.4980.4370.66142.41
EV/FCF Ratio
111.37266.92181.58108.6670.63156.83
Debt / Equity Ratio
0.010.010.010.010.020.03
Debt / EBITDA Ratio
0.010.010.020.020.040.06
Debt / FCF Ratio
0.020.020.030.030.040.07
Net Debt / Equity Ratio
-0.47-0.81-0.82-0.86-0.87-0.72
Net Debt / EBITDA Ratio
-0.56-1.32-1.36-1.42-1.43-1.38
Net Debt / FCF Ratio
-1.44-1.88-1.88-1.92-1.44-1.53
Asset Turnover
0.580.720.700.700.660.62
Inventory Turnover
4.124.205.798.248.3814.20
Quick Ratio
5.346.385.905.244.394.87
Current Ratio
6.236.495.985.314.464.97
Return on Equity (ROE)
76.80%51.82%50.71%50.43%48.46%43.49%
Return on Assets (ROA)
49.51%33.09%30.68%29.26%27.12%24.09%
Return on Invested Capital (ROIC)
112.62%268.45%299.63%363.36%240.38%147.73%
Return on Capital Employed (ROCE)
67.70%53.40%50.60%49.10%47.10%39.50%
Earnings Yield
1.63%0.39%0.55%0.89%1.01%0.50%
FCF Yield
0.89%0.37%0.55%0.91%1.39%0.63%
Dividend Yield
0.29%0.19%0.29%0.47%0.52%0.26%
Payout Ratio
24.49%42.63%44.15%43.05%42.27%43.92%
Buyback Yield / Dilution
-0.04%-0.01%-0.06%-0.01%0.01%-0.13%
Total Shareholder Return
0.25%0.19%0.23%0.46%0.53%0.13%
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.